Description: Metropolitan Avenue - The south side of Metropolitan Ave. opposite Andrews Ave. The far house left of center is the Daniel T. White House (1860 & 1873). The closest house, which was opposite the Daniel Adee House, belonged to Wallace Vandewater. Both houses were demolished, and the site became Grover Cleveland High School and grounds.
